You can buy an unlocked Blackberry Storm touch screen phone from the moment the cell phone is released, but the price may be too high for some at around $699.99 (US) and £649.99 (UK). How would you buy the Blackberry Storm, locked or unlocked?
Both versions of the RIM’s (NASDAQ:RIMM) first touch screen BlackBerry phone have the same specs, so lets remind you of the main features. These include on-screen SureType keyboard, full HTML browser, 3.2MP camera, a touch sensitive 3.2-inch display, voice dialing, video capture, memory card slot, 3G, GPS, Email client, Bluetooth and a lot more.
In the shares news, Research In Motion (RIMM) saw a boost today thanks to strong sales of the BlackBerry Bold and ahead of the first touch-screen BlackBerry in the U.S. this week. RIM do have heavy competition from Apple’s (AAPL) iPhone 3G, but this has not affected the share price.
